#c4f0c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4f0cf is composed of 76.9% red, 94.1%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 135 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 85.5%. #c4f0c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#89e19f.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#c4f0c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4f0cf has RGB values of R:196, G:240,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 12906703.

Shades and Tints of #c4f0cf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010402 is the darkest color, while #f3f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4f0cf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d8dcd9 is the less saturated color, while #b6fec8 is the most saturated one.
